« Back to run

Function Details

Nette\DI\Container::getByType

Current function

Function Call Count Self Wall Time Self CPU Self Memory Usage Self Peak Memory Usage Inclusive Wall Time Inclusive CPU Inclusive Memory Usage Inclusive Peak Memory Usage
Nette\DI\Container::getByType
Percent of total request
921 18,087 µs 12,668 µs 46,368 bytes 40,584 bytes 156,858 µs
(7 %)
154,578 µs
(7 %)
7,588,760 bytes
(18 %)
7,655,640 bytes
(17 %)

Parent functions

Function Call Count Self Wall Time Self CPU Self Memory Usage Self Peak Memory Usage Inclusive Wall Time Inclusive CPU Inclusive Memory Usage Inclusive Peak Memory Usage
main()
Percent of total request
1 67 µs µs -12,712 bytes bytes 2,412,439 µs
(100 %)
2,261,572 µs
(100 %)
41,857,656 bytes
(100 %)
44,257,072 bytes
(100 %)
Nette\DI\Container::Nette\DI\{closure}@3
Percent of total request
20 123 µs µs 2,840 bytes 3,848 bytes 45,120 µs
(2 %)
48,001 µs
(2 %)
747,040 bytes
(2 %)
754,656 bytes
(2 %)
Nette\DI\Container::Nette\DI\{closure}
Percent of total request
1409 4,608 µs 7,729 µs 2,840 bytes 4,056 bytes 232,999 µs
(10 %)
238,261 µs
(11 %)
8,650,760 bytes
(21 %)
8,688,048 bytes
(20 %)
Andweb\Datatypes\Descriptors\DescriptorFactory::Andweb\Datatypes\…
Percent of total request
16 89 µs µs 696 bytes 440 bytes 4,940 µs
(0 %)
5,795 µs
(0 %)
54,384 bytes
(0 %)
63,680 bytes
(0 %)
App\FrontModule\Presenters\FrontPresenter::getControlFactory
Percent of total request
33 331 µs µs 1,664 bytes 400 bytes 2,044 µs
(0 %)
µs
(0 %)
9,824 bytes
(0 %)
9,880 bytes
(0 %)
Nette\DI\Extensions\InjectExtension::checkType
Percent of total request
59 294 µs µs 664 bytes bytes 1,282 µs
(0 %)
µs
(0 %)
1,248 bytes
(0 %)
bytes
(0 %)
Nette\DI\Extensions\InjectExtension::callInjects
Percent of total request
68 1,762 µs µs -19,712 bytes bytes 44,736 µs
(2 %)
42,163 µs
(2 %)
62,456 bytes
(0 %)
648,248 bytes
(1 %)

Child functions

Function Call Count Inclusive Wall Time Inclusive CPU Inclusive Memory Usage Inclusive Peak Memory Usage
Nette\DI\Helpers::normalizeClass 921 5,900 µs 6,766 µs 13,784 bytes 20,392 bytes
Nette\DI\Container::getService 915 45,367 µs 43,512 µs 755,960 bytes 820,744 bytes
Nette\DI\Container::getService@3 4 95 µs µs 5,280 bytes 6,792 bytes
Composer\Autoload\ClassLoader::loadClass 463 73,510 µs 71,632 µs 5,022,600 bytes 5,036,184 bytes
PHPStan\PharAutoloader::loadClass 93 333 µs µs 568 bytes bytes
{closure} 93 190 µs µs 552 bytes 200 bytes
Nette\Loaders\RobotLoader::tryLoad 93 13,376 µs 20,000 µs 1,743,648 bytes 1,730,744 bytes